A member asked:

I noticed a bump closest to the anus at the vaginal opening. its painless and can be moved around and its flesh colored, can it be herpes or a cyst?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Skin Tag, Hemorroid: A painless, flesh colored tag around the anus could be a skin tag or a tag from an old hemorroid. Herpes typically starts out as a painful bump and then can be filled with clear fluid. The area around the herpes infection is red and painful. A sebaceous cyst is a little harder, filled with thick sebaceous material which can typically be squeezed out. You could also have a condyloma.
